Output 8da620e3379e6c7d1a345244dacb764a9134eb67cb1e434fad2eeef2d711a6c8:0

value
141564
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c929e38976f1320b3705a8062b1522ebdd47a194 OP_EQUAL
address
3L2fvb36voFPfeBNRPqwDg7cHAyd2VECfF
transaction
8da620e3379e6c7d1a345244dacb764a9134eb67cb1e434fad2eeef2d711a6c8
confirmations
360287
spent
true